Transaction 033626f956912337ad84c1df36ed82338a88fab5228a0570132ef77cb036e85f

block
745e92465d0564d689b7a34c7e51d0ee54ce7a8aaa7dbe28fb5c70ff6bc195b2

1 Input

21 Outputs